dc.description.abstractWith the passage of time, the history and unique culture of each nation develops. In particular, the Uzbek people have a rich national culture that is the envy of every nation. In this article, we covered the educational and historical development of dutor, which is a part of our culture, one of our national instruments, performance methods, schools created by master dutor players, based on the scientific research of our musicologists
